Cardiovascular drugs market covers the drugs
used to treat conditions that affect the heart or blood vessels. These conditions
include heart stroke, coronary artery diseases, valvular diseases, peripheral
venous diseases, pericarditis, endocarditis, cardiac tumors, arteriosclerosis,
and lymphatic diseases. Some of the major cardiovascular drugs include
anti-hypertensive drugs such as calcium channel blockers and Angiotensin II
receptor antagonists, and hypolipidemic drugs such as fibric acid derivatives
and bile acid binding resins.

The major reasons why the global
cardiovascular drugs market will increase from $130 billion in 2017 to $140
billion by 2021 are the increase in aging population, increase in the
prevalence of cardiovascular diseases and availability of more generic drugs
that reduce the cost of treatment.
In the report, the global cardiovascular drugs
market is divided into four segments namely, anti-hypertensive drugs, other
drugs for cardiovascular diseases, hypolipidemics and anti thrombotics. While
the first and the second segment accounts for nearly three-fifth of the market,
the remaining share is attributed to other two segments.
The USA was the largest
country in the cardiovascular drugs market in 2017, accounting for nearly
one-fourth of the market share. The factors attributed to the size of this
market include good quality healthcare services, high healthcare expenditure,
high levels of regulation and patent protection and the GDP of the country. Japan and
Germany followed the USA as the next largest countries in the market.
The cardiovascular drugs market is fragmented
with a number of large and small drug organizations. The top five competitors
in the market made up around 20% of the total market in 2017. Merck & Co.
was the largest competitor of the market, followed by Sanofi S.A. and Pfizer
Inc. Merck & Co. was founded in 1891 and is headquartered in New Jersey,
USA. It offers therapeutic and preventive health solutions through prescription
medicines, vaccines, biologic therapies and animal health products. Merck &
Co. serves drug wholesalers and retailers, hospitals, government agencies and
entities, physicians, physician distributors, veterinarians, distributors,
animal producers, and managed health care providers.
